#d18654 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d18654 is composed of 82% red, 52.5%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35.9% magenta, 59.8%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 24 degrees, a saturation of 57.6% and a lightness of 57.5%. #d18654 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a8 with #a30d00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#d18654 color description : Moderate orange.

#d18654 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d18654 has RGB values of R:209, G:134,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.36, Y:0.6,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13731412.

Shades and Tints of #d18654

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0804 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d18654

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#97928e is the less saturated color, while #fb7e2a is the most saturated one.
